The Aspenwood Company, a leader in the senior living industry has an opportunity for an experienced Resident Care Coordinator at Village of Southampton, an Independent Living, Assisted Living with Memory Care senior community.
Pay Rate: $22.00/hr.
Tuesday - Saturday | 11:00 a.m. - 7:00 p.m.
The Resident Care Coordinator is responsible for providing medication management and may provide direct care to residents following an individual service plan as indicated. Must treat each resident with respect and dignity, recognizing individual needs, and encouraging independence. Fosters a homelike atmosphere throughout the community. Must desire to work with seniors and ensure a person-centered culture is implemented and practiced. Abides by and upholds company core values.
